A STUDY OF MICROELECTRONIC CIRCUIT PARAMETERS FOR NON-DIGITAL APPLICATIONS.

Abstract

Microelectronics is introduced with definitions for some of the more controversial terms encountered in this new field. Thin-film resistive elements are examined from the distributed parameter point of view and impedance functions for use in microcircuit analysis are derived. A source of parasitic capacitance found in silicon integrated transistors is introduced by way of a sample calculation. A small signal analysis for a simple linear amplifier stage is presented using microcircuit concepts along with transistor circuit theory.
